HEC Paris welcomed 11 new research professors to its faculty ranks for this new academic year, one of the richest pickings in years. The top-class scholars join seven of the school’s nine departments, swelling HEC’s total of professor-researchers to 120.
Professor Armin Steinbach has been awarded a Jean Monnet Chair in European Union Studies by the European Commission. Armin will hold the Chair in EU Law and Economics until 2025.

Itzhak Gilboa, Professor of Economics and Decision Sciences at HEC Paris, has been ranked 6th theoretical economist in the world in a study by Stanford University.
